S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br />ENVIRONMENTAL HEALTH DEPARTMENT <br />600 East Main Street, Stockton, California 95202-3029 <br />Telephone: (209) 468-3420 Fax: (209) 468-3433 Web: www.sigov.org/ehd/unitiii.htmi <br />CONTINUATION FORM <br />Page: 3 of 4 <br />OFFICIAL INSPECTION REPORT <br />Date: 10/27/10 <br />Facility Address: Cherokee Lane Service Station 900 Cherokee Ln Lodi, CA 95240 <br />Program: UST <br />S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br />(CLASS I, CLASS 11, or MINOR -Notice to Comply) <br />On site to perform the routine inspection and witness the annual monitoring system certification testing. <br />#3 UST tank forms on file with the EHD are not current. Any change of information on these forms must <br />be submitted to the EHD within 30 days of the changes. Immediately complete and submit a copy of the <br />facility and tank forms to the EHD. Complete a separate tank form for each tank. <br />#4 Financial responsibility documents have not been submitted to the EHD. Current financial <br />responsibility documents are required to be submitted annually. Complete and submit a copy of the <br />financial responsibility immediately. <br />#5 & 6 Current approved copies of the monitoring and response plans were not found on site. The <br />monitoring and response plans must be current and approved by the EHD. Complete and submit a copy <br />of the response plan for approval by the EHD by 11-27-10. An approved copy will be returned for your <br />records. <br />#7 Maintenance records for the 9-3-10 diesel stp sensor alarm, 2-18-10 diesel stp, 87A stp, 91 stp, 87B <br />stp, diesel/87 annular, and 91/87 annular sensor alarms were not found on site. These records shall be <br />kept on site for at least 3 years . Immediately locate and maintain the maintenance records for the <br />9-3-10 diesel stp sensor alarm, 2-18-10 diesel stp, 87A stp, 91 stp, 87B stp, diesel/87 annular, and <br />91/87 annular sensor alarms on site and submit copies to the EHD by 11-27-10. <br />#11 The 87A stp and diesel stp sump sensor was raised approximately 5 inches off the lowest point of <br />the sump almost 1/4 up from the bottom of the saddle and not located to detect a leak at the earliest <br />opportunity. Monitoring equipment shall be maintained to be able to detect a leak at the earliest possible <br />opportunity. Technician corrected this during the inspection by repositioning the sensor to the lowest <br />part of the stp sump. <br />#13 The Bravo box float and chain in the north diesel main udc failed to stop the flow of product at the <br />dispenser when tested. All monitoring equipment shall be maintained to activate an audible and visual <br />alarm or stop the flow of product at the dispenser when it detects a leak. The service technician <br />adjusted the chain and verifies functionality. <br />#21 Liquid was observed in the south diesel satellite udc. If water could enter into the secondary <br />containment by precipitation or infiltration, it must be removed and disposed of properly.
